How to Successfully Declutter Your Home in 3 Easy Ways

The Benefits of Decluttering

While initially decluttering might seem like a ton of work, the advantages of a clutter-free home are lasting and beneficial. Clutter can become a huge problem in your home if you let it pile it up. A messy home is linked to stress and too much stuff in your house can even be a hazard.

The first major benefit of clearing out junk is creating a more stress-free environment. When you have fewer things around you, you tend to feel more open and relaxed. It’s also fewer things to clean, which reduces your chores in the long run.

Decluttering is also good money-wise. Committing to keeping your home clutter-free means less spending on unnecessary material things.

Finally, you can focus more on your passions or hobbies. Organized, junk-free spaces are more conducive to creativity and productivity. Without possessions and financial worries taking up your focus, you can do things like teaching yourself how to cook or learning a new language.

Steps to Successfully Declutter Your Home

When it comes to clearing out the junk in your house, there are 3 easy ways to get the job done. Here are our 3 steps for decluttering a home.

  1. Make a Plan

Depending on the scope of your clutter, you’ll need a plan before diving in. Mapping out how to approach the clutter problem will keep you calm and organised as you go through this process. Set goals for yourself so you can feel positive about accomplishing them.

One goal could be to tackle one room at a time, with a clutter completion date for each one. You could also focus on specific areas of the house that might be more cluttered than others.

When surveying your clutter, try rating the severity of the mess on a scale of 1 to 3. You can attack the hardest rooms first to get them finished or start with the easier rooms to motivate yourself.

  1. Sort

You’ve set your house clearance goals, now it’s time to go through your junk. To make the process easier, sort things by what you want to keep, to throw away, and to store. At this stage, you’ll need to be realistic. The sorting system won’t work if you decide to keep everything!

The sorting method works well for a total junk overhaul of your home, but it will take time. If you want to go through things little by little, there are a few other methods you can use. The 12-12-12 method, for example, whereby you find 12 things to keep, 12 to give away, and 12 to toss.

You can also grab a big bag and fill it with things to donate – the trick here is not to stop sorting until the bag is full. With little tasks like these, going through old junk is less overwhelming.

  1. Get Rid of Stuff

You’ve set your goals and sorted your junk. Now it’s time to get rid of the “throwaway” boxes of stuff or take the “donate” boxes to charity. There are several ways to get rid of junk, depending on what it is. Any rubbish you have you could try to recycle, like paper, plastics, and glass.

Things that can’t be taken away with recycling pickup you can donate to charities or thrift stores. Be sure to check donation guidelines before hauling all of your stuff to the donation centre, though.

Finally, when it comes to house clearance and rubbish removal, you can call experts. Professionals in rubbish removal will know exactly how to handle the items you no longer want or need. Hiring a company for junk removal is usually cheaper than renting a dumpster, too.
